The past 30 days in Hampden crime
- There were 7 reported incidents of violent crime in the past 30 days. That's more than the 3 30 days before that and more than the monthly average in the last 12 months of 5.2 per month in Hampden.
- Domestic violence: No incidents the past 30 days, 0 the 30 days before that. The 12-month monthly average is 0.0.
- Sex assault: No incidents the past 30 days, 0 the 30 days before that. The 12-month monthly average is 0.0.
- Robbery: 1 incident the past 30 days, 0 the 30 days before that. The 12-month monthly average is 1.2.
- Burglary: 6 incidents the past 30 days, 4 the 30 days before that. The 12-month monthly average is 4.1.
- Property crimes: 33 incidents the past 30 days, 40 the 30 days before that. The 12-month monthly average is 40.9.
- Car thefts: 4 incidents the past 30 days, 15 the 30 days before that. The 12-month monthly average is 12.1.
- Bike thefts: No incidents the past 30 days, 0 the 30 days before that. The 12-month monthly average is 0.1.

Monthly crimes in Hampden
Monthly violent crime in Hampden
In the last 48 months, the average number of crimes in a month was 10.6 and the median was 11.0. The most in any month was 18, in May 2023, and the least was four in March 2025.
Monthly property crime in Hampden
In the last 48 months, the average number of crimes in a month was 125.0 and the median was 119.5. The most in any month was 197, in October 2022, and the least was 51 in October 2025.
So far this year, Hampden ranks in reported crime rates:
Rankings range from 1st (worst) to 78th (best).
- 50th (out of Denver's 78 neighborhoods) in violent crimes per 1,000 residents (down from 40th last year. 2.86 violent crimes per 1,000 residents this year, 5.14 up until this point last year)
- 53rd in population-adjusted property crimes (down from 49th in 2024. 22.58 property crimes per 1,000 residents in 2025, 28.89 in 2024)
- 60th in population-adjusted sexual assaults (down from 31st in 2024. 0.0 sexual assaults per 1,000 residents in 2025, 0.74 in 2024)
- 60th in population-adjusted domestic violence crimes (down from 25th in 2024. 0.0 domestic violence crimes per 1,000 residents in 2025, 3.6 in 2024)
- 47th in population-adjusted robberies (down from 38th in 2024. 0.74 robberies per 1,000 residents in 2025, 1.11 in 2024)
- 67th in population-adjusted burglaries (down from 59th in 2024. 2.12 burglaries per 1,000 residents in 2025, 3.55 in 2024)
- 31st in population-adjusted car thefts (down from 26th in 2024. 6.73 car thefts per 1,000 residents in 2025, 10.92 in 2024)
- 77th in population-adjusted bike thefts (down from 66th in 2024. 0.05 bike thefts per 1,000 residents in 2025, 0.27 in 2024)
- 51st in population-adjusted drug crimes (up from 58th in 2024. 1.27 drug crimes per 1,000 residents in 2025, 0.85 in 2024)
